The broken lines and the sidewall region between the broken lines that define the inner bead and the sidewall depict subject matter that forms no part of the claimed tire design and are included for the purpose of illustrating the full tire. Likewise, the tire interior forms no part of the claim. The tread pattern is understood to repeat throughout the circumference of the tire, and the top and bottom views are the same as the front view based on the repeating nature of the tread design pattern.

The dashed broken lines indicating an enlargement portion of the design form no part of the claimed design.
